SOUTH THAILAND

Wat Suan Mokkh, Chaiya, Surat Thani 84110, tel. (077) 431552, 431661-2, fax 431597, dhammadana@usa.net, www.suanmokkh.org/

Ten days meditation retreat (Anapanasati), from 1st to 10th of each month. Teaching in English by monks or lay disciples of late Ven. Ajahn Buddhadasa. Reservations unnecessary, please register before 3:00 pm at the end of previous month.

Wat Kow Tham, PO Box 18, Koh Pah Ngan, Surat Thani 84280, watkowtahm@watkowtahm.org, www.watkowtahm.org,

Ten and twenty-day vipassana meditation retreats. Teachings in English by Steve and Rosemary Weissman. Pre-register early, space is limited. For retreats dates and information please contact the Wat directly.

A Guide to Buddhist Monasteries and Meditation Centres in Thailand, by Bill Weir, and IBMC Guide to Buddhist Meditation Retreats in Thailand, by Helen Jandamit. These two little yellow books will give you detailed information about monasteries and meditation centers in Thailand, as well as a thorough introduction about meditation retreats. Available in book shops.
